Amit Dhurandhar Paul Gader

In this paper we show how the distribution of the discrete Choquet integral can be analytically computed. The advantage of having an analytical expression is that the value of the cumulative distribution function (cdf) can be computed exactly for the Choquet. We also derive an expression for the density of the Ordered Weighted Average (OWA) operator, which is a special case of the Choquet.
